What is Home Decor Ideas?
Home Decor Ideas is a visual inspiration app for interior design, offering a curated gallery of styles for homeowners and DIY enthusiasts on Android.
Users hire this app for quick visual discovery of room aesthetics, serving the need for low-friction design ideas during the planning phase of home projects.

Who is FOREFO?
FOREFO operates as a high-volume content aggregator, leveraging a standardized template-based app architecture to capture search traffic across fragmented lifestyle and design niches. Their strategy relies on rapid deployment of visual catalogs rather than feature-rich utility, effectively functioning as a mobile-first SEO play for users seeking specific aesthetic references. The primary tension in their model is the reliance on static image galleries in an era where users increasingly favor short-form video content for tutorials and style inspiration.

Key Takeaways
Home Decor Ideas provides a basic visual gallery but lacks the utility to retain high-intent users, so the PM should pivot to affiliate-linked monetization to capture value from the existing traffic.
Where Is It Heading?
Stable
The home decor market is shifting toward functional utility and AR-enabled visualization. The app's current static model leaves it exposed to more interactive rivals, so the PM must introduce utility-driven features to prevent churn.
The app remains in a maintenance-only state, which risks losing relevance as competitors integrate AR and smart-home management features.
